    1st gen Trd supercharger for 5vz-fe.

    It spins smooth and is in really nice condition. Just check out the zinc coating on all the hardware and fittings, you rarely see them like this. I dont think this has too many miles on it, although I dont know the actual mileage. I got it off an old man who said the whine was annoying and took it off. It had been sitting in his garage since then.

    It came with the static tensioner but I've upgraded to the Dynamic tensioner. I cut the old bracket to support the nose of the SC and clear the new tensioner.

    I've also ordered some new parts from Magnuson, Dip stick bracket, Throttle body gasket, Check valve.

    What's included:
    1st gen supercharger
    Static support bracket
    Belt
    Static support hardware
    Rear support hardware
    1 long bolt
    4 throttle body bolts
    New Dynamic tensioner
    New tensioner bracket and hardware
    New Check valve
    New Throttle gasket
    New Dip stick bracket

    What's missing:
    2 long bolts to mount Sc, can use All-thread and make new ones
    Vacuum hoses/T fittings
    Throttle cable bracket

    What else I recommend:
    IK22 spark plugs
    91 Octane
    Aem Fic 6 or 7th injector kit
    190lph fuel pump
    Wide band O2
